Search a number
-
+
1507862655300 = 2235233115184921
BaseRepresentation
bin10101111100010011100…
…111100011000101000100
312100011001112121102010010
4111330103213203011010
5144201100314432200
63112411425430220
7213640146044601
oct25742347430504
95304045542103
101507862655300
11531532182721
1220429819b370
13ac26336bb71
1452da39c16a8
15293527b5150
hex15f139e3144

1507862655300 has 72 divisors (see below), whose sum is σ = 4375930082272. Its totient is φ = 400881888000.

The previous prime is 1507862655251. The next prime is 1507862655311. The reversal of 1507862655300 is 35562687051.

It is a hoax number, since the sum of its digits (48) coincides with the sum of the digits of its distinct prime factors.

It is a self number, because there is not a number n which added to its sum of digits gives 1507862655300.

It is an unprimeable number.

It is a polite number, since it can be written in 23 ways as a sum of consecutive naturals, for example, 7493161 + ... + 7691760.

Almost surely, 21507862655300 is an apocalyptic number.

1507862655300 is a gapful number since it is divisible by the number (10) formed by its first and last digit.

It is an amenable number.

1507862655300 is an abundant number, since it is smaller than the sum of its proper divisors (2868067426972).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

1507862655300 is a wasteful number, since it uses less digits than its factorization.

1507862655300 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 15185269 (or 15185262 counting only the distinct ones).

The product of its (nonzero) digits is 1512000, while the sum is 48.

The spelling of 1507862655300 in words is "one trillion, five hundred seven billion, eight hundred sixty-two million, six hundred fifty-five thousand, three hundred".

Divisors: 1 2 3 4 5 6 10 12 15 20 25 30 50 60 75 100 150 300 331 662 993 1324 1655 1986 3310 3972 4965 6620 8275 9930 16550 19860 24825 33100 49650 99300 15184921 30369842 45554763 60739684 75924605 91109526 151849210 182219052 227773815 303698420 379623025 455547630 759246050 911095260 1138869075 1518492100 2277738150 4555476300 5026208851 10052417702 15078626553 20104835404 25131044255 30157253106 50262088510 60314506212 75393132765 100524177020 125655221275 150786265530 251310442550 301572531060 376965663825 502620885100 753931327650 1507862655300